It's actually true. My Grandma Marilyn lost her husband( Sam ) but not from being hit by a car, and met Jack who lost his wife at a bereavement place and later got married. Jack was very dependent on his wife as shown in the movie which is true. They never showed Jack and Marilyn in the movie getting married though. The real Jack and Marilyn were in the movie but didn't have any lines and were shown for only a few seconds in some scenes. The new years dance was something that my Grandma said she went to and the director said that she thought it would be good to put into the movie as well. I'm not sure who the people Marilyn and jack meet in the movie, but I think thats the part of the real story that that ends.
